LG Nexus 5 and Android 4.4 KitKat become official




The LG Nexus 5 smartphone is now become official. The Google Nexus 5 smartphone is manufactured by LG and runs on the latest version of Android namely 4.4 KitKat. We earlier saw Nexus 5 in rumors, Leaks and speculation but now it's official and up for sale. The new LG Nexus 5 sports a 5-inch 1080p HD display, with 1080p resolution and is protected by Gorilla Glass 3. It has a 2.3GHz Qualcomm Snapdragon 800 chipset with four Krait 400 cores and Adreno 330 GPU. The other features of the Nexus 5 are a 2GB of RAM, Android 4.4 KitKat OS, a 1.3megapixels front-facing camera, and 8 megapixels OIS rear camera with LED flash, and a 2,300mAh battery.

The dimension of the LG Nexus 5 are 137.84 x 69.17 x 8.59mm and weighs just 130g. In terms of connectivity the Nexus 5 has 3G, 4G LTE, Wi-Fi a/b/g/n/ac, Bluetooth 4.0 LE, A-GPS, NFC and even. It will available in Black and White color option with 16 GB or 32 GB of storage. Presently the smartphone is available for purchase in the UK, US, Canada in North America, France, Germany, Spain and Italy in Europe, plus Australia, Japan and Korea. The device is also scheduled to release in Inida pretty soon.


The Google Nexus 5 with 16GB version contains the price tags of $349 / €349 / £300. On the other hand the 32GB versions are $400 /€400 / £340.

The Android 4.4 KitKat that debuts with the Nexus 5 is a latest version of Android OS. Android 4.4 KitKat includes a new phone app, that offers amazing features and helps you search across your contacts, nearby places or even through any other Google app accounts. It is pre-installed on Nexus 5.

The new version of Android includes Google’s new Hand out app that store all you SMS and MMS at one place along with other conversation of Video calls. It has a better Lock screen with camera shortcut that allows you to rearrange your home screen.

It has many new features of Google search which allows you to activate search through keywords and speech recognition. This search is 25 percent more enhance than the previous one. The Google Now allows you to launch voice search, you can send messages get directions or even play a song. The new version of Google Now now features new card types that keep you updated with contextual topics of interest to you.

The Android 4.4 KitKat OS includes lots of other features too an now  now supports third-party cloud storage in the Gallery app. Google aims to make Android accessible to everyone, even people with low-end hardware.

Samsung to bring Galaxy Mega 6.3 Smartphone to US Cellular,AT&T, Sprint



Samsung has officially declared the arrival of its new Galaxy Mega 6.3 smartphone in the US. The new Samsung Galaxy Mega 6.3 handset will be available for sale at Sprint, AT&T and US Cellular.
The carriers will have the two color versions of Galaxy Mega 6.3 including black and white. The price details have not been disclosed yet but all the three carriers will start selling the Mega 6.3 smartphone this month.

The Samsung Galaxy Mega 6.3 sports a 6.3 inch display with 1280 x 720 pixels. It runs Android 4.2 Jelly Bean (upgradeable to 4.3), further featuring: LTE connectivity, NFC, 8MP rear camera with LED flash, 1.9MP front-facing camera, dual-core Snapdragon 400 processor clocked at 1.7GHz, 1.5GB of RAM, and 8GB / 16GB of expandable memory.

Motorola Moto X by Google hands-on

Moto-XThe much awaited Motorola Moto X by Google has officially been announced in the USA. The Moto X – the first phone by the company in a while to be fully assembled in the USA. With modest hardware specifications, the Motorola Moto X is a stunning device comprising a 4.7″ AMOLED display with full RGB matrix and 720p resolution.  The phone is the second after the iPhone to track the nano SIM standard.

The Moto X is powered by Motorola’s X8 Mobile Computing System that pairs two Qualcomm Snapdragon S4 Pro chipset, 1.7GHz Dual Core Krait CPUs, an Adreno 320 GPU and a 2GB of RAM.
The internal storage of Moto X is 16GB or 32GB depending on the version but without a card slot for expandable memory. It comprises 2,200 mAh battery to last up to 24 hours. The Moto X feature 10 MP rare-facing camera with a 1/2.5″ 1.4 um 10 MP sensor with an f2.4 lens. A 2 megapixel Full HD camera is on the front too that is capable of 1080p video recording.Motorola Moto X
The Motorola Moto X runs Android 4.2 Jelly Bean operating system. Other features of the mobile phones are Bluetooth 4.0, USB 2.0, 802.11a/b/g/n/ac, GPS and GLONASS, a standard 3.5mm headphone jack, Miracast Wireless Display and NFC.
Motorola Moto X features a preinstalled a transfer app called Migrate which permits you to transfer your photos, videos, SIM contacts from any Android phone running Android 2.2 or greater.
The phone comprises the curved back which varies the thickness from 5.6 to 10.4mm and weight is 130 grams.MotoX-2
The Motorola Moto X by Google will be available for sale the five largest cellular operators in the USA including AT&T, Verizon, Sprint, T-Mobile and US Cellular.
